Output 3bb29c351071e6844863fa2a08874f382acaca2f5c491622c8cc457792bd86e4:15

value
588870
script pubkey
OP_0 OP_PUSHBYTES_20 12b109f12c976486a54b190d5f3dea26370b76d8
address
bc1qz2csnufvjajgdf2tryx47002ycmskakccn3h3a
transaction
3bb29c351071e6844863fa2a08874f382acaca2f5c491622c8cc457792bd86e4
spent
false